How To Write Resume For Traveling Secretary

  • Highlight your experience in planning and coordinating international travel arrangements for executives.
  • Showcase your ability to negotiate competitive rates and manage expense reports effectively.
  • Demonstrate your knowledge of travel regulations and safety protocols.
  • Emphasize your strong customer service and communication skills.
  • Include a portfolio of your work, if possible, to showcase your planning and coordination abilities.

Essential Experience Highlights for a Strong Traveling Secretary Resume

Maximize your Traveling Secretary job prospects by strategically including these proven experience elements.
  • Plan and coordinate international travel arrangements for executives, including flights, accommodation, and transportation.
  • Manage expense reports for travel and related costs, ensuring accuracy, timely submission, and adherence to company policies.
  • Negotiate and secure competitive rates with airlines, hotels, and transportation providers, resulting in significant cost savings.
  • Develop and implement a travel policy that streamlines approval processes, reduces costs, and enhances employee compliance.
  • Collaborate with internal stakeholders, including HR, finance, and legal, to ensure compliance with company policies, travel regulations, and legal requirements.
  • Conduct comprehensive risk assessments and develop contingency plans to mitigate potential travel disruptions, ensuring the safety and wellbeing of travelers.
  • Provide exceptional customer service to travelers, addressing inquiries and resolving issues promptly and effectively.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’s) For Traveling Secretary

  • What are the key responsibilities of a Traveling Secretary?

    The key responsibilities of a Traveling Secretary include planning and coordinating international travel arrangements for executives, managing expense reports, negotiating competitive rates, developing and implementing travel policies, collaborating with internal stakeholders, conducting risk assessments, and providing exceptional customer service.

  • What are the qualifications for a Traveling Secretary?

    The qualifications for a Traveling Secretary typically include a Bachelor’s degree in Hospitality or Travel Management, experience in planning and coordinating international travel, and strong customer service and communication skills.

  • What are the different types of travel arrangements that a Traveling Secretary may be responsible for?

    A Traveling Secretary may be responsible for a variety of travel arrangements, including flights, accommodation, transportation, visas, and other logistics.

  • How can I become a Traveling Secretary?

    To become a Traveling Secretary, you can pursue a Bachelor’s degree in Hospitality or Travel Management, gain experience in planning and coordinating travel arrangements, and develop strong customer service and communication skills.

  • What are the benefits of being a Traveling Secretary?

    The benefits of being a Traveling Secretary include the opportunity to travel the world, meet new people, and learn about different cultures.

  • What are the challenges of being a Traveling Secretary?

    The challenges of being a Traveling Secretary include long hours, irregular work schedules, and the need to be available at all times.

  • What are the advancement opportunities for a Traveling Secretary?

    The advancement opportunities for a Traveling Secretary include becoming a Travel Manager, Event Planner, or Corporate Travel Agent.

  • What are the salary expectations for a Traveling Secretary?

    The salary expectations for a Traveling Secretary vary depending on experience, location, and company size. However, the average salary for a Traveling Secretary is around $60,000 per year.
